With their own motion in the Bundestag, the CDU and CSU want to put pressure on the German government to provide Ukraine with much more military support than before.

In the draft of a motion for a resolution, which is available to the FAZ, the Union calls for German arms deliveries to be "immediately and noticeably increased in quantity and quality."

According to the will of the Union, the deliveries should also include heavy weapon systems from the Bundeswehr, which the Federal Government has not yet planned.

Battle tanks and armored personnel carriers are mentioned, as are artillery systems.

In addition: Long-range reconnaissance equipment, command and control equipment, protective equipment, means of electronic warfare, rifles, ammunition, anti-aircraft missiles, anti-tank weapons - i.e. material that does not fall under "heavy weapons" and parts of which have already been made available to Ukraine.

You could also say: Everything that is somehow superfluous and helps the Ukrainians to fight the Russian aggressors.

In addition to material from the Bundeswehr itself, in its draft application, the Union also urges decisions to be made “immediately” on offers from the armaments industry that could be used to fill gaps that arise in the event that they hand over equipment and weapons to Ukraine.

The government should also decide “immediately” on offers from the armaments industry to deliver material and weapons directly to Ukraine.

Furthermore, the Union is calling for military aid to be coordinated centrally in the Federal Chancellery and for the agency to be set up to be commissioned “immediately” with implementation, a “task force” made up of experts from the Bundeswehr Procurement Office for Ukraine to be formed and for the training of Ukrainian soldiers on the systems to help in cooperation with international partners.

"Germany must now join its allies in the EU and NATO and make a determined contribution to strengthening the Ukrainian self-defense forces - also and especially with "heavy weapons", according to the Union faction.

However, a majority for the application is considered unlikely.

The governing parties want to submit their own application.
